Transaction ebfc205d1d6baadb32e977ad64756323fa5fd3fda6f6624af1cb5a827c67f9b4
1 Input
1 Output
-
ebfc205d1d6baadb32e977ad64756323fa5fd3fda6f6624af1cb5a827c67f9b4:0
- value
- 599548
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d7b3fc4bdd48020cc17ec32642ac56990ff951e
- address
- bc1qr4anl39a6jqzpnqhasexg2k9dxg0l9g7zlyaap